My father narrated to me from Aḥmad ibn Idrīs, from ‘Amraki, from Sandal, from Dāwūd ibn Farqad, who said: I asked Abā ‘Abdillāh (Imam Sādiq (a.s.)), “What is the reward for those who go to the Ziyārah of Ḥusain (a.s.) every month?” Imam (a.s.) replied, “They will earn the reward of one hundred thousand martyrs like the martyrs of (the Battle of) Badr.”
